A killa or acre is measured rectangularly, reckoned as an area 36 karams (198 ft) x 40 karams (220 ft) (43,560 square ft). 1 /5th of a killa or acre is known as bigha 1 Karam = 5.5 feet = 1.83 ... Different areas have different size of Bigha, ... WebHow to Convert Acre to Hectare. 1 ac = 0.4046856422 ha 1 ha = 2.4710538147 ac. Example: convert 15 ac to ha: 15 ac = 15 × 0.4046856422 ha = 6.0702846336 ha. WebThe size of a Basketball court is about 0.04956377184 hectares. (per NBA regulation) Per NBA rules , a basketball court should measure 29.5656 m long by 16.764 m wide, for a total area of 0.04956377184 hectares.
